View All NewsJapan – Jaic full year revenue up 15.7% as it returns to profit
Jaic (7073: TYO), a Japan-based professional services firm primarily engaged in education-integrated recruitment services, reported revenue today for the full year period ended 31 January 2022 of JPY 2.59 billion (USD 21.9 million), an increase of 15.7% compared to the same period last year.
(JPY millions) | FY 2021 | FY 2020 | Change | FY 2021 (USD millions) |
Revenue | 2,593 | 2,241 | 15.7% | 21.9 |
Gross Profit | 2,434 | 2,098 | 16.0% | 20.6 |
Operating Income | 91 | -281 | - | 0.7 |
Net Income | 90 | -221 | - | 0.7 |
The Japan-based company is primarily engaged in education-integrated recruitment services. The college business is provides education-integrated human resource introduction services and educational opportunities for SMEs with less than 300 employees. The company is also engaged in the provision of a wide range of detailed education and training services.
Jaic’s college business saw revenue jump by 8.1% from the previous year.
The group forecasted revenue of JPY 2.90 billion (USD 24.5 million) for the year ended January 2023.
Shares in Jaic closed at JPY 2,255.00 (USD 19.11), up 2.04% on the day and 6.87% above its 52-week low of JPY 2,110.00 (USD 17.88), set on 2 March 2022. The company has a market cap of JPY 2.04 billion (USD 17.3 million).
